我是python的新手,但是我试图创建一个自动化过程,其中我的代码将侦听目录中的新文件条目。例如,某人可以手动将zip文件复制到一个特定的文件夹中,并且我希望我的代码能够在文件完全复制到该文件夹后识别出该文件。然后,代码可以进行一些操作,但这无关紧要。目前,我的代码仅每5秒检查一次新文件,但这对我来说似乎效率很低。有人可以提出一些更异步的建议吗?
在Perl中,为什么我从parsedate(2010-7-2 13:0:0)和解析(2010-7-2 13:00:0)得到不同的结果?
我有以下字典:
mydict = {
'foo': [1,19,2,3,24,52,2,6], # sum: 109
'bar': [50,5,9,7,66,3,2,44], # sum: 186
'another': [1,2,3,4,5,6,7,8], # sum: 36
'entry': [0,0,0,2,99,4,33,55], # sum: 193
'onemore': [21,22,23,24,25,26,27,28] # sum: 196
}
Run Code Online (Sandbox Code Playgroud)
我需要通过数组的总和有效地过滤和排序前x个条目.
例如,上面示例的前3个排序和筛选列表将是
sorted_filtered_dict = {
'onemore': [21,22,23,24,25,26,27,28], # sum: 196
'entry': [0,0,0,2,99,4,33,55], # sum: 193
'bar': [50,5,9,7,66,3,2,44] # sum: 186
}
Run Code Online (Sandbox Code Playgroud)
我对Python很陌生,并且自己尝试在lambda函数上链接一个sum和filter函数,但是在实际的语法上却很挣扎.
我的代码:
#!/bin/sh
#filename:choose.sh
read choose
[ "$choose" == "y" -o "$choose" == "Y" ] && echo "Yes" && exit 0
[ "$choose" == "n" -o "$choose" == "N" ] && echo "No" && exit 0
echo "Wrong Input" && exit 0
Run Code Online (Sandbox Code Playgroud)
但是当我执行时
sh ./choose.sh
Run Code Online (Sandbox Code Playgroud)
终端提示我
[: 4: n: :Unexpected operator
[: 5: n: :Unexpected operator
Run Code Online (Sandbox Code Playgroud)
我的bash脚本有什么错误吗?谢谢!
我有一个nvarchar SQL列,主要包含数值.我正在尝试提出一个L2S表达式,它可以获取最大数值而忽略任何非数字值.
执行此任务的SQL是:
select top 1 value from identifier where and patindex('%[^0-9]%', value) = 0 order by CAST(value AS INT) desc
Run Code Online (Sandbox Code Playgroud)
我可以使用什么LINQ表达式来实现同样的目的?
我从python.org的python-2.7.amd64.msi包中安装了Python 2.7.它安装并正确运行,但似乎是在32位模式下,尽管安装程序是64位安装程序.
Python 2.7 (r27:82525, Jul 4 2010, 07:43:08) [MSC v.1500 64 bit (AMD64)] on win32
Type "help", "copyright", "credits" or "license" for more information.
>>> import sys, platform
>>> platform.architecture()
('64bit', 'WindowsPE')
>>> sys.maxint
2147483647
Run Code Online (Sandbox Code Playgroud)
我该怎么做才能安装Python以便它实际上以64位模式运行?
嘿那里,我已经安装了wordpress多站点和域映射插件.
问题是与www ...如果我设置多站点没有www和我访问网站没有www一切正常但如果我访问它没有www,它reddirects到主站点.任何想法为什么?泰
我想用PHP获取MySQL数据库表中的最后一个结果.我该怎么做呢?
我在表中有2列,MessageID(自动)和消息.
我已经知道如何连接数据库了.
假设我有这两个字符串:"5/15/1983"和"1983.05.15".假设字符串中的所有字符都是数字,除了可以出现在字符串中任何位置的"分隔符"字符.只有一个分隔符; 字符串中任何给定的非数字字符的所有实例都是相同的.
如何使用正则表达式提取此字符?有没有比下面更有效的方式?
"05-15-1983".replace(/\d/g, "")[0];
Run Code Online (Sandbox Code Playgroud)
谢谢!